What You Need to Smoke Tri Tip Camping

The first thing you’ll need is a smoker. Fortunately, there are a variety of small smokers that are designed for camping. There are electric smokers, charcoal smokers, and even wood smokers. The type you choose will depend on what is available and what you prefer. You’ll also need wood chips, charcoal, or pellets, depending on the type of smoker you choose. You’ll also need a thermometer to make sure you’re cooking the tri tip at the right temperature.

Preparing the Tri Tip

Once you have all the equipment you need, you’ll need to prepare the tri tip. Start by trimming the fat off the meat. This will help the meat cook evenly and it will also prevent it from becoming too fatty. You’ll also want to season the meat with salt, pepper, and any other seasonings you prefer. Let the meat sit for a few hours before you start cooking it.

Lighting the Smoker

Once the tri tip is prepared, it’s time to light the smoker. If you’re using a charcoal smoker, you’ll need to light the charcoal first. You can use lighter fluid or a charcoal chimney to get the charcoal started. Once the charcoal is lit, add the wood chips or pellets. If you’re using an electric smoker, fill the water pan and plug it in. Once the smoker is lit, let it preheat for at least 15 minutes.

Smoking the Tri Tip

Once the smoker is preheated, it’s time to start smoking the tri tip. Place the tri tip on the grate and close the lid. Let the tri tip cook for about 1 hour. Check the temperature every 30 minutes to make sure it’s cooking evenly. Once the tri tip reaches an internal temperature of 135°F, it’s done. Remove the tri tip from the smoker and let it rest for 10 minutes before slicing and serving.

What is tri tip?

Tri tip is a cut of steak from the bottom sirloin that is popular in the United States. It is a lean cut of meat that is full of flavor.

How should I store smoked tri tip?

Smoked tri tip should be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 4 days. It can also be frozen for up to 6 months.
